Why Many Soccer Fans Prefer Online Streams Over Cable Subscriptions

 
Soccer is probably the most popular sport in the world, and millions of fans never wish to miss a match. For decades, cable television was the primary way to watch games, offering dedicated sports channels with live coverage. But in recent years, the trend has shifted. More and more soccer fans are leaving cable subscriptions behind and turning to on-line streaming services. The reasons are clear: flexibility, affordability, accessibility, and a better overall viewing experience.
 
 
Flexibility and Comfort
 
 
One of many biggest advantages of on-line soccer streaming is flexibility. Fans are no longer tied to their living rooms or limited to 1 television set. With streaming services, matches will be watched on laptops, tablets, or smartphones. Whether at home, on the go, or even at work during a lunch break, soccer fans can comply with their favorite teams without lacking a moment.
 
 
Unlike cable TV, the place game occasions and channels are fixed, on-line platforms usually provide on-demand replays and highlights. This makes it easier for viewers in different time zones to compensate for matches at their convenience. Flexibility has develop into a major reason why on-line streaming is overtaking traditional television.
 
 
Cost Savings Compared to Cable
 
 
Another driving factor is cost. Cable packages that include sports channels might be expensive, typically bundled with dozens of channels viewers never use. Many soccer fans are frustrated with paying high month-to-month fees just to access a handful of games.
 
 
Streaming services, however, tend to be more affordable and customizable. Fans can subscribe only to the leagues, teams, or tournaments they care about. For example, some platforms focus solely on European competitions, while others concentrate on South American leagues. This targeted approach saves cash and ensures fans only pay for what they need to watch.
 
 
Access to More Leagues and Matches
 
 
Cable television typically limits coverage to probably the most popular leagues or the matches with the most important audiences. However soccer is a global game, and fans are interested in a lot more than just one or two competitions. On-line streaming has solved this problem by offering access to a wide range of leagues from totally different countries.
 
 
A fan in the United States can easily stream matches from the English Premier League, Spanish La Liga, Italian Serie A, or even smaller regional leagues that cable networks not often cover. This international access has made on-line platforms particularly interesting to die-hard soccer fans who crave variety.
 
 
Better Quality and Options
 
 
One other reason fans prefer on-line streams is the quality of the viewing experience. Streaming platforms typically provide high-definition (HD) or even 4K broadcasts, along with options for a number of camera angles, live statistics, and real-time commentary. These options go far beyond what traditional cable offers.
 
 
Interactive chat rooms, social media integration, and live commentary options additionally permit fans to interact with the game in new ways. The ability to pause, rewind, or watch highlights immediately provides streaming services an edge that cable simply cannot match.
 
 
Availability Without Long-Term Contracts
 
 
Cable subscriptions typically lock clients into long-term contracts, making it tough to cancel or switch providers. On-line streaming services, nevertheless, normally operate on a month-to-month basis. This gives fans the liberty to cancel at any time when they select or switch between services depending on which competitions are in season.
 
 
This level of control is very appealing for younger generations who worth flexibility and dislike being tied down by commitments. The liberty to pick and select has turn out to be some of the compelling reasons fans are cutting the cord.
 
 
 
The shift from cable subscriptions to online soccer streams reflects a broader trend in how folks eat entertainment. Soccer fans need flexibility, affordability, and world access, and streaming services deliver on all three fronts. With higher quality, interactive features, and freedom from contracts, on-line platforms have quickly turn out to be the preferred selection for millions of fans around the world.
 
 
As technology continues to evolve, it is likely that online streaming will totally replace cable for sports broadcasting within the close to future. For soccer fans, this means more matches, better coverage, and a richer viewing expertise than ever before.
